UFPR to Congress: Ensure PTO Prioritizes Patent Quality by Maintaining a Balanced and Effective IPR

Stephanie Martz and Paul Redifer, co-chairs of United For Patent Reform sent a letter to Thom Tillis, Chris Coons, Lindsey Graham, and Dianne Feinstein ahead of today's hearing on patent quality: “Promoting the Useful Arts: How can Congress prevent the issuance of poor quality patents?”
